Daily The Hindu Vocabulary | 01.12.2022
1. TERMINATE (VERB): (ā¤¸ā¤Žā¤žā¤ĒāĨ⤤ ā¤ā¤°ā¤¨ā¤ž): End
Synonyms: Close, Conclude
Antonyms: Begin
Example Sentence:
He was advised to terminate the contract.
2. SLAM (VERB): (ā¤ā¤˛āĨā¤ā¤¨ā¤ž ā¤ā¤°ā¤¨ā¤ž): Criticize
Synonyms: Find fault with, Censure
Antonyms: Praise
Example Sentence:
The new TV soap was slammed as being cynical and irresponsible.
3. CONCEDE (VERB): (⤏āĨā¤ĩāĨā¤ā¤žā¤° ā¤ā¤°ā¤¨ā¤ž): Admit
Synonyms: Acknowledge, Accept
Antonyms: Deny
Example Sentence:
I had to concede that I overreacted at his behaviour.
4. INTENT (ADJECTIVE): (ā¤ĻāĨā¤ĸā¤ŧ-⤏ā¤ā¤ā¤˛āĨā¤Ē): Determined
Synonyms: Bent, Set
Antonyms: Half-hearted
Example Sentence:
The government was intent on achieving greater efficiency.
5. DETRIMENTAL (ADJECTIVE): (ā¤šā¤žā¤¨ā¤ŋā¤ā¤žā¤°ā¤): Harmful
Synonyms: Damaging, Injurious
Antonyms: Benign
Example Sentence:
Recent policies have been detrimental to the interests of many old people.
6. JEOPARDY (NOUN): (ā¤ā¤ŧā¤¤ā¤°ā¤ž): Peril
Synonyms: Danger, Risk
Antonyms: Safety
Example Sentence:
The whole peace process is in jeopardy.
7. INDICTMENT (NOUN): (⤠ā¤ā¤ŋ⤝āĨā¤): Charge
Synonyms: Accusation, Arraignment
Antonyms: Acquittal
Example Sentence:
It is an indictment for conspiracy.
8. EXUDE (VERB): (ā¤āĨā¤Ąā¤ŧā¤¨ā¤ž): Discharge
Synonyms: Release, Emit
Antonyms: Absorb
Example Sentence:
The beetle exudes a caustic liquid.
9. DIVINE (ADJECTIVE): (ā¤Ļā¤ŋā¤ĩāĨ⤝): Godly
Synonyms: Godlike, Angelic
Antonyms: Mortal
Example Sentence:
Heroes seldom have divine powers.
10. COLD SHOULDER (VERB): (⤰āĨā¤ā¤ž ā¤ĩāĨ⤝ā¤ĩā¤šā¤žā¤° ā¤ā¤°ā¤¨ā¤ž): Snub
Synonyms: Ignore,Slight
Antonyms: Acknowledge
Example Sentence:
She was cold-shouldered by almost everyone.

NATIONAL SPORTS AWARDS 2022-
đ The Union Ministry of Sports and Youth Affairs has announced the National Sports Awards 2022 on 14 November 2022.
đ These Awards will be presented by the President on 30 November 2022.
đ The Awardees will receive their awards from the President of India at a specially organized function at Rashtrapati Bhavan on 30th November, 2022.
âââââââââââââââââââ
âī¸ The six core awards which constitute India's National Sports Awards are..
1. Major Dhyan Chand khel Ratna Award (khel Ratan)
2. Arjuna Award
3. Dronacharya Award
4. Dhyan Chand Award
5. Maulana Abdul Kalam Azad Trophy (Maka Trophy)
6. Rashtriya khel protsahan Puruskar
âââââââââââââââââââ
âĢī¸ MAJOR DHYAN CHAND KHEL RATNA AWARD (khel RatanHighest Sports Award in India)
đ Institute in - 1991-1992
đ Case prize - Rs 25 Lakh
đ First Recipient - Grandmaster Vishwanathan Anand (1991-1992)
đ Youngest Recipient - Shooter Abhinav Bindra
đ 1st Women Recipient - Karnam Malleswari (1994-1995)
đ Major Dhyan Chand khel Ratna Award 2022 -
đ Achanta Sharath Kamal - Table Tennis (Tamil Nadu)
âââââââââââââââââââ
âĢī¸ ARJUN AWARD
đ 25 sportspersons to be honoured with Arjuna Award in 2022
đ Instituted in - 1961
đ Cash Prize - Rs 15 Lakh
âŖī¸ Arjun Award 2022
đ Seema Punia (Athletics)
đ Eldhose Paul (Athletics)
đ Avinash Mukund Sable (Athletics)
đ Lakshya Sen (Badminton)
đ HS Prannoy (Badminton)
đ Amit (Boxing)
đ Nikhat Zareen (Boxing)
đ Bhakti Pradip Kulkarni (Chess)
đ R Praggnanandhaa (Chess)
đ Deep Grace Ekka (Hockey)
đ Shushila Devi (Judo)
đ Sakshi Kumari (Kabaddi)
đ Nayan Moni Saikia (Lawn Bowl)
đ Sagar Kailas Ovhalkar(Mallakhamb)
đ Elavenil Valarivan (Shooting)
đ Omprakash Mitharval(Shooting)
đ Sreeja Akula (Table Tennis)
đ Vikas Thakur (Weightlifting)
đ Anshu (Wrestling)
đ Sarita (Wrestling)
đ Parveen (Wushu)
đ Manasi Girishchandra Joshi (Para Badminton)
đ Tarun Dhillon (Para Badminton)
đ Swapnil Sanjay Patil (Para Swimming)
đ Jerlin Anika J (Deaf Badminton)
âââââââââââââââââââ
âĢī¸ DRONACHARYA AWARD
đ Instituted in - 1985
đ For Outstanding coaches in sports & Games
đ Cash prize - 15 Lakh
đ It's Devided into two Categories -
âī¸ A - Regular Category
âī¸ B - Lifetime Category
âŖī¸ A - Regular Category 2022
đ Jiwanjot Singh Teja (Archery)
đ Mohammad Ali Qamar (Boxing)
đ Suma Siddharth Shirur (Para Shooting)
đ Sujeet Maan (Wrestling)
âŖī¸ B - Lifetime Category -
đ Dinesh Jawahar Lad - Cricket
đ Shri Bimal Prafulla Ghosh - Football
đ Shri Raj Singh - Wrestling
âââââââââââââââââââ
âĢī¸ DHYAN CHAND AWARD FOR LIFETIME ACHIEVEMENT -
đ Instituted - 2002
đ Cash Prize - Rs 10 Lakh
âŖī¸ Dhyan Chand Award for Lifetime achivement in Sports 2022 -
đ Ashwini Akkunji C (Athletics)
đ Dharamvir Singh (Hockey)
đ B C Suresh (Kabaddi)
đ Nir Bahadur Gurung (Para Athletics)
âââââââââââââââââââ
âĢī¸ RASHTRIYA KHEL PROTSAHAN PURUSKAR 2022
đ TransStadia Enterprises Private Limited,
đ Kalinga Institute of Industrial Technology,
đ Ladakh Ski & Snowboard Association
âââââââââââââââââââ
âĢī¸ MAULANA ABUL KALAM AZAD TROPHY -
đ Instituted - 1956 - 57
đ Cash Prize -
đ 1st Position - Rs 15 Lakh
đ 2nd & 3rd Position - Rs 7.5 Lakh
âŖī¸ Maulana Abul Kalam Azad Trophy 2022 -
đ Guru Nanak Dev University, Amritsar (23rd Times Winner)

Daily The Hindu Vocabulary | 02.12.2022
1. WORRISOME (ADJECTIVE): (ā¤ā¤ŋā¤ā¤¤ā¤žā¤ā¤¨ā¤): Worrying
Synonyms: Daunting, Alarming
Antonyms: Reassuring
Example Sentence:
The situation was becoming worrisome day by day.
2. INUNDATE (VERB): (ā¤Ŧā¤žā¤ĸā¤ŧ ā¤˛ā¤žā¤¨ā¤ž): Flood
Synonyms: Deluge, Overflow
Antonyms: Drain
Example Sentence:
The islands may be the first to be inundated as sea levels rise.
3. CONVENE (VERB): (ā¤ŦāĨā¤˛ā¤žā¤¨ā¤ž): Summon
Synonyms: Call, Order
Antonyms: Disperse
Example Sentence:
He had convened a secret meeting of military personnel.
4. SIGNIFICANTLY (ADVERB): (ā¤ĩā¤ŋā¤ļāĨ⤎ā¤ā¤°): Notably
Synonyms: Remarkably, Outstandingly
Antonyms: Slightly
Example Sentence:
Energy bills have increased significantly this year.
5. TROUBLED (ADJECTIVE): (ā¤ā¤ŋā¤ā¤¤ā¤ŋ⤤):Anxious
Synonyms: Worried, Concerned
Antonyms: Unworried
Example Sentence:
We felt very bad looking at her troubled face.
6. BONHOMIE (NOUN): (ā¤āĨā¤ļā¤Žā¤ŋā¤ā¤ŧā¤žā¤āĨ): Geniality
Synonyms: Conviviality, Affability
Antonyms: Coldness
Example Sentence:
He emits good humour and bonhomie.
7. REMOTE (ADJECTIVE): (⤠⤏ā¤ā¤ā¤žā¤ĩāĨ⤝): Unlikely
Synonyms: Improbable, Implausible
Antonyms: Likely
Example Sentence:
Chances of a lasting peace became even more remote.
8. REMISS (ADJECTIVE): (ā¤ŦāĨā¤Ē⤰ā¤ĩā¤žā¤š): Negligent
Synonyms: Neglectful Irresponsible
Antonyms: Careful
Example Sentence:
It would be very remiss of me not to pass on that information.
9. IMMUNE (ADJECTIVE): (ā¤Ŧā¤ā¤ž ā¤šāĨā¤): Resistant
Synonyms: Not subject to, Unsusceptible
Antonyms: Susceptible
Example Sentence:
They are immune from legal action.
10. FIASCO (NOUN): (⤠⤏ā¤Ģā¤˛ā¤¤ā¤ž): Failure
Synonyms: Disaster, Catastrophe
Antonyms: Success
Example Sentence:
His plans turned into a fiasco.

âžī¸LIST OF G20 SUMMIT :-
â 1st G20 Summit 2008 : USA
â 16th G20 summit 2021 : Italy
â 17th G20 summit 2022 : Indonesia.
â 18th G20 summit 2023 : India.
â 19th G20 summit 2024 : Brazil.
â 20th G20 Summit 2025 : South Africa.
